Transaction a7068e4486dd7f4cda4d7393fb78991fa33fd70e60e43eb260a5660d6094d7e5

block
8c7b17400f433c444d10dcb1519407f2694967545c59bc20b83574f960b00737

39 Inputs

39 Outputs